Stand Up To Cancer extended to the end of November to give community members more time to participate in the worthwhile cause.
Approximately 1500 people die from cancer each day despite aggressive action to find a cure for the disease. AndrosForm, a men’s fitness and lifestyle blog, is enlisting the help of its blog readers and surrounding communities to help raise money to further cancer research in an effort to find a cure. The popular blog launched its campaign to raise money for the fight against cancer on November 7, 2011 and will donate proceedings to the cancer initiative group, Stand Up to Cancer.
AndrosForm began their giveaway contest with the intention of ending it on November 10, 2011, but media and blog community attention has raised awareness of the campaign and the blog’s administrators have extended the deadline through the end of November to give community members more time to participate in the worthwhile cause.
“The giveaway contest has really picked up steam and we want to raise as much money as possible for cancer research. We simply couldn’t stop while word of the contest continued to spread” stated an androsForm spokesperson.
Stand Up to Cancer was formed in 2008 and is comprised of people involved in all areas of cancer, including patients, doctors, and lawmakers, in an effort to further research of cancer treatment, leading to an eventual cure. Cancer is the second deadliest disease in the world, and statistics show that everyone knows at least one person who’s been diagnosed with some form of cancer. For every contest entry form androsForm receives, they’ve pledged to donate 10 cents to Stand Up to Cancer.
Carie Small, nominee for “All Fantasy Player” of the 2010 Lingerie Football League lends her face to the campaign along with androsForm through the donation of Carie Small “Tackle Cancer” T-shirts for the contest’s five winners. As a cancer survivor, Small takes a special interest in the fight to find a cure for cancer. In addition to the five top prizes, several other winners will be chosen for prizes including Edible Arrangements and other t-shirts.
A third-party hosting service, provided by 63squares, is working with androsForm to monitor contest entries and ensure the correct proceeds are allocated to Stand Up to Cancer. Entry forms will be accepted through 11:59pm EST on November 30, 2011.
